ブログ - PsPing
ネットワークの疎通確認で一番原始的なコマンドはping.これはICMPで通信相手との疎通を確認するためのものだけれど,じゃぁ,HTTPの80番とか特定のポートに対しての疎通確認はどうやって行うか.
むかしはtelnet 127.0.0.1 80 という感じでTELNETコマンドを使っていたけれど,ターミナルソフトとして暗号化されてない点を評価されて,TELNETがインストールされてないUnix(linux)も多い.WindowsでもTELNETサービスを追加でインストールが必要だけれど,SysInternalsで提供されるPSToolsにあるPsPingコマンドを使えば良いことがわかった.
Yahoo!に443接続してみる.
TELNETとPINGの中間的な感じかな.このPsPingは,インストーラを使ったインストールは不要だけれど,ファイルをダウンロードしてこなければいけないので,今時のセキュリティ事情からは,この代替え手段もNGかなぁ.
PsPing v2.1
https://docs.microsoft.com/en-us/sysinternals/downloads/psping
むかしはtelnet 127.0.0.1 80 という感じでTELNETコマンドを使っていたけれど,ターミナルソフトとして暗号化されてない点を評価されて,TELNETがインストールされてないUnix(linux)も多い.WindowsでもTELNETサービスを追加でインストールが必要だけれど,SysInternalsで提供されるPSToolsにあるPsPingコマンドを使えば良いことがわかった.
Yahoo!に443接続してみる.
C:\Users\ujpadmin>C:\Users\ujpadmin\Desktop\PSTools\psping64.exe www.yahoo.jp:443🆑
PsPing v2.10 - PsPing - ping, latency, bandwidth measurement utility
Copyright (C) 2012-2016 Mark Russinovich
Sysinternals - www.sysinternals.com
TCP connect to 182.22.71.250:443:
5 iterations (warmup 1) ping test:
Connecting to 182.22.71.250:443 (warmup): from 192.168.99.6:53554: 9.41ms
Connecting to 182.22.71.250:443: from 192.168.99.6:53555: 9.95ms
Connecting to 182.22.71.250:443: from 192.168.99.6:53556: 10.18ms
Connecting to 182.22.71.250:443: from 192.168.99.6:53557: 10.61ms
Connecting to 182.22.71.250:443: from 192.168.99.6:53558: 9.87ms
TCP connect statistics for 182.22.71.250:443:
Sent = 4, Received = 4, Lost = 0 (0% loss),
Minimum = 9.87ms, Maximum = 10.61ms, Average = 10.15ms
C:\Users\ujpadmin>
PsPing v2.1
https://docs.microsoft.com/en-us/sysinternals/downloads/psping